The Corporation for Public Broadcasting and public television viewers provide funding for Masterpiece.
Masterpiece has been presented on PBS by WGBH since 1971. The series is closed-captioned for deaf and hard-of-hearing viewers by The Caption Center at WGBH. A special narration track is added to the series by Descriptive Video Service® (DVS®), a service of WGBH to provide access to people who are blind or visually impaired.
